The Model 340PD is part of Smith & Wesson's renowned AirLite series, designed to provide maximum firepower without the burden of heavy metal. Its scandium alloy frame and titanium cylinder make it one of the lightest revolvers in its class, weighing just over 11 ounces. Despite its featherweight design, it doesn't compromise on performance, capable of delivering the formidable stopping power of the .357 Magnum cartridge. The revolver's Double Action Only (DAO) mechanism ensures reliability and simplicity, essential for high-stress scenarios. Its compact 1.88" barrel and sleek black/matte silver finish make it an ideal companion for discreet carry, while its textured rubber grip offers a secure hold for enhanced control.
